Katie Piper’s Brave Leap: Starting a New Chapter with an Artificial Eye

Katie Piper has spent over 16 years showing the world what true resilience looks like. And now, with her decision to wear a prosthetic eye, she’s writing another powerful chapter in her story—one rooted in healing, grace, and growth.

Her Instagram post was as heartfelt as you’d expect: “I’ve reached the end of the road somewhat,” she shared. For Katie, that meant moving on from years of eye complications and embracing a solution that offers both relief and empowerment.

A prosthetic eye isn’t about hiding scars—it’s about making life just a little bit easier. These thin, custom-made shells are fitted over damaged eyes to improve appearance and comfort. While they can’t bring back vision, they often restore something equally important: a sense of normalcy.

Katie’s been managing pain and sensitivity for years. Choosing the shell wasn’t about fear. It was about freedom.

It takes guts to share something so personal. Katie not only made her decision public, but she filmed the fitting and posted it online. The act was classic Katie—vulnerable, bold, and deeply inspiring.

She thanked the NHS and private doctors who’ve been by her side every step of the way. Gratitude has always been a key part of her outlook, and she shares it freely.

After the attack, Katie had to rebuild her face, her identity, and her life. She’s had more surgeries than most people could count. But what’s more incredible is how she used that journey to support others. Her foundation gives hope and resources to burn victims, and her voice continues to break down stigma around scars.

She’s written bestsellers, produced documentaries, and received an OBE for her work. But the impact she’s had can’t be measured by awards alone—it’s written on the hearts of the people she’s helped.
